When to Use

  • You converted a paper PDF to Markdown and need to verify that Results text matches figure legends (without inspecting the images).
  • You want to detect missing figure references in the Results section (e.g., a legend describes an analysis not mentioned in text).
  • You need to find numerical/label mismatches (e.g., group names, time points, units, n-values) between Results paragraphs and legends.
  • You are preparing a revision and want an actionable discrepancy list down to the panel/sub-figure level.
  • You need standardized outputs (Markdown report + CSV) for editorial or QA workflows.

Key Features

  • Compares Results descriptions vs figure legend text using the PDF-to-Markdown source (including ## Page XX markers).
  • Produces:
    • A Markdown consistency report (UTF-8).
    • A CSV issue list (UTF-8) with structured fields for tracking and revision.
  • Enforces a template-based report format using assets/consistency_template.md.
  • Uses a rule/checklist reference from references/guide.md.
  • Text-only validation: does not read figure images and does not infer visual content.

Example Usage

Input

Place the converted full text Markdown in your working location (example: inputs/paper_fulltext.md). The file should include page headers like:

## Page 12
... Results text ...

Figure 3. ...
(A) ...
(B) ...

Run (conceptual workflow)

  1. Read the full Markdown input (PDF conversion output).
  2. Identify:
    • Result paragraphs describing findings.
    • Figure legend blocks (including panel labels such as A/B/C).
  3. Compare legend statements against Results statements and record discrepancies.
  4. Write outputs to outputs/:
    • outputs/consistency_report.md (UTF-8)
    • outputs/consistency_issues.csv (UTF-8)

Output files

outputs/consistency_issues.csv (UTF-8) columns:

Figure Number,Location/Reference,Issue Description,Suggested Revision,Priority

Notes:

  • Location/Reference must contain only Page XX.
  • Issues should be granular to the panel/sub-figure level when applicable.

outputs/consistency_report.md (UTF-8) must follow:

  • Template: assets/consistency_template.md
  • If no issues are found, write "None found" in the relevant sections.

Implementation Details

  • Scope of comparison

    • Only compare main text Results descriptions and figure legend text present in the Markdown input.
    • Do not inspect images or infer information not explicitly stated in text.
  • Rules and checklist

    • Follow the specific checking rules and required output points defined in:
      • references/guide.md
  • Report formatting

    • The Markdown report must be generated by filling:
      • assets/consistency_template.md
    • Ensure all outputs are saved under:
      • outputs/ (within the skill directory)
  • Granularity and actionability

    • Record discrepancies at the most specific level possible (e.g., Figure 2B vs Figure 2 overall).
    • Provide a concrete Suggested Revision whenever feasible (e.g., align terminology, correct numbers/units, add missing reference).
  • Language

    • Default output language is Chinese.
    • If the user explicitly specifies another language, output in that language.
